I love my 08. One of the things that attracted me to the MINIs was the way they sound. The prince engine has a very unique sound to it. It throws my hubby a bit when I drive, but as for me, I love it. A key feature to me in a car, is knowing how it sounds. Once you get used to the way the car is supposed to sound when its running right, you can tell when it's not. You may not know what is wrong, but at least you know something is out of whack and can take it in to have someone that knows more about cars than you do take a look.

I can't handle some of the high end luxury cars that are out there that are all about the quiet. I *need* to hear the engine rumbling and purring, I need noise. Otherwise, I just have no confidence in my car.

The 08, lost none of that quality for me over the 04 that I test drove. The torque steer is annoying in the 2nd gens, but I can get past that when I realize that I have an automatic and the transmission won't need to be replaced in 60,000 miles as was common with the CVT in the first gens.

I'd love to see them TRY to pull that bad gas routine on me. If it happens, I'll see if I can't put it up on youtube.

The one that would really kill me, would be if they ever accused me of using cheap gas. I've heard that rumor, and Viola is only fed V-Power.

I had hubby drive around with me tonight in the MINI because I had been noticing this issue more and more and it worried me and he actually laughed at me. He said, "Your problem sweetheart, is that you've never driven a manual before and you've never driven a real car before. The car's downshifting into first." and me, not being a gearhead at all, sat in the driver's seat for a second and said, "No no, I know what that feels like and it's not the same as what I'm describing." So when we got back onto the road home and there were no other cars around, I took my foot off the gas and demonstrated my issue. The car downshifts into first, and then there are two more little stutters afterwards. Hubby explained in more detail that it was, in fact, the car downshifting into first. He said the MINI does not want to coast and I drove bigger, heavier cars before that I coasted a lot. So the car is downshifting into first when I take my foot off the gas, and then, when I don't immediately put on the brake, but instead let the car roll... it wants to shift again.

He said that the same thing happened in our corolla. I just never noticed it before because there was almost no pedal feel in the corolla. With the MINI, there's feedback for more of what the car is actually doing in the pedal and in the steering wheel... and while I knew that, it never occurred to me that it was just feedback through the pedal until I paid attention to it. To me, it felt like the whole car was stuttering and it really threw me.

Lesson learned. I am wiser now, and I really was being an over-reactive parent.
